I don't think those are original colors, but I had a 1971 once that I repainted with the original dark olive metalic(506), and used used the medium olive metalic(504) for the top and side stripe where it was white before, looked pretty good to me .

It looks like medium olive green. Code for '72 is 504, medium olive. I painted my truck that color but whoever mixed it put too much yellow. I like the color just fine though
